Ringless Voicemail: A Spammer's Best Friend?

Wiki Article

With its capacity to deliver unsolicited messages without ringing a phone, ringless voicemail has become a popular tool for spammers. These annoying robocalls leave pre-recorded greetings directly on recipients' voicemail inboxes, often advertising questionable products or services. While some may argue that ringless voicemail is a helpful feature for legitimate business purposes, its exploitation by spammers has created serious concerns among consumers and regulators alike.

Silent But Deadly: Exposing Ringless Voicemail Scams

These days, staying safe online is crucial more than ever. Criminals are constantly finding clever schemes to scam unsuspecting people, and one of the most insidious is the ringless voicemail scam. Unlike traditional phone scams that involve ringing your phone, these scams deliver malicious messages without ever making a noise. This makes them incredibly dangerous because victims often aren't aware they've been targeted until it's too late.

Ringless voicemail scams typically involve spammers using automated software to deliver thousands of pre-recorded messages to random phone numbers. These messages often masquerade as legitimate calls from banks, government agencies, or even family members. They may pressure you to click on a link or call back a number that leads to malware infection or further scams.
